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, aesthetically appealing roofing systems using natural slate materials. This process typically includes precise measurement, pattern layout, and careful placement of slate tiles to ensure a secure and weather-resistant roof. Skilled contractors focus on proper alignment and fastening techniques to maximize the longevity and visual appeal of the slate roofing, which can enhance the overall appearance of a property while providing a sturdy barrier against the elements.

One of the primary issues slate roof construction addresses is the need for a long-lasting roofing solution that can withstand harsh weather conditions, such as heavy rain, snow, and wind. Slate roofs are known for their durability and resistance to common roofing problems like leaks, rot, and insect damage. Proper installation helps prevent water infiltration, which can lead to structural damage and mold growth. Additionally, a well-constructed slate roof can improve insulation and energy efficiency, contributing to lower heating and cooling costs over time.

Properties that typically utilize slate roof construction include historic homes, luxury residences, and buildings with architectural significance. Slate roofing is often chosen for its classic appearance and ability to complement traditional or period-specific designs. Commercial buildings, especially those aiming for an elegant or distinguished aesthetic, may also opt for slate roofing. Due to the weight of slate tiles, structures require appropriate support and framing to accommodate the installation, making professional expertise essential for successful projects.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in East Berlin,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ost to install a new slate roof typically ranges from $30,000 to $50,000 for an average-sized home in East Berlin, CT. Larger or more complex structures may see prices exceeding $60,000. These estimates depend on roof size and design specifics.

Material Expenses - The price of slate roofing materials generally falls between $10 and $20 per square foot. Premium or imported slates can increase material costs, affecting the overall project budget. Material costs are a significant portion of total expenses.

Repair and Replacement - Repairing a slate roof can cost between $1,000 and $5,000 depending on the extent of damage. Full replacement of damaged sections or entire roofs may range from $15,000 to $40,000. Costs vary based on roof size and condition.

Maintenance and Inspection - Routine inspections and minor repairs typically cost around $200 to $500 per visit. More extensive maintenance or restoration projects can range from $2,000 to $8,000. Regular upkeep helps prolong the lifespan of slate roofs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of slate roof construction?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for historic and high-end properties.

How long does a slate roof typ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, slate roofs can last 75 years or more, often outlasting other roofing materials.

What factors influence the cost of slate roof construction? Costs can vary based on the size of the roof, the type of slate used, complexity of the design, and local labor rates.

Are there different types of slate suitable for roofing? Yes, common types include natural slate and synthetic slate, each with different appearances and performance characteristics.
